Beat the heat: All of the City of Toronto outdoor pools mapped

19 June 20252 Mins Read

It’s going to be a hot one out there this weekend, Toronto. Forecasts are showing temperatures reaching the 30s, and that means one thing: time to hit the water. City of Toronto has a bunch of public pools that are free to access, so you can lounge, swim and stay out of the heat at no cost.

While there are outdoor pools all over Toronto, we’ve created a map so you can find your closest location and plan accordingly.

No more begging your friends with a condo pool to let you come over, am I right?

According to the City of Toronto, most outdoor pools will open on June 21 on a partial schedule:

  • Monday to Friday: 4 to 8 p.m.
  • Saturday and Sunday: 10 a.m. to 8 p.m.

And June 27 on a full schedule:

  • Monday to Sunday: 10 a.m. to 8 p.m.

This weekend marks the start of summer, and what better way to celebrate than by lounging poolside?

Stay cool in one of the City of Toronto pools and happy summer, everyone!
